Changeset 28571


Ignore:
Timestamp:
05/29/14 22:40:45 (5 years ago)
Author:
rvelices
Message:

bug 3082: random key generation algorithm

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/include/functions_session.inc.php

    r26461 r28571  
    6363function generate_key($size) 
    6464{ 
    65   global $conf; 
    66  
    67   $md5 = md5(substr(microtime(), 2, 6)); 
    68   $init = ''; 
    69   for ( $i = 0; $i < strlen( $md5 ); $i++ ) 
    70   { 
    71     if ( is_numeric( $md5[$i] ) ) $init.= $md5[$i]; 
    72   } 
    73   $init = substr( $init, 0, 8 ); 
    74   mt_srand( $init ); 
    7565  $key = ''; 
    7666  for ( $i = 0; $i < $size; $i++ ) 
Note: See TracChangeset for help on using the changeset viewer.